您好,登录后才能下订单哦!
密码登录
登录注册
点击 登录注册 即表示同意《亿速云用户服务条款》
# TP5怎么引入CSS文件
在ThinkPHP5(TP5)框架中引入CSS文件是前端开发的基础操作。本文将介绍三种常用方法,帮助开发者快速实现样式文件的引入。
## 一、通过静态资源目录引入
TP5默认的静态资源目录是`public/static/`,推荐将CSS文件存放在此目录下:
1. 在`public/static/`下创建`css`文件夹
2. 将CSS文件(如`style.css`)放入该目录
3. 在模板文件中使用:
```html
<link rel="stylesheet" href="/static/css/style.css">
注意:TP5.1+版本可能需要使用
__STATIC__
常量:> <link rel="stylesheet" href="{:__STATIC__}/css/style.css"> > ``` ## 二、使用视图助手函数 TP5提供了`asset`助手函数简化路径生成: ```html <link rel="stylesheet" href="{:asset('css/style.css')}">
此方法会自动指向public/static/
目录,无需手动写完整路径。
对于第三方CSS库(如Bootstrap),推荐直接使用CDN:
<link href="https://cdn.jsdelivr.net/npm/bootstrap@5.1.3/dist/css/bootstrap.min.css" rel="stylesheet">
缓存问题:开发时可添加版本号防止缓存:
<link href="/static/css/style.css?v=<?= time() ?>" rel="stylesheet">
路径问题:
/
开头多模块情况:如果使用多模块,建议在public/static/
下建立对应模块目录,如:
public/static/admin/css/
public/static/home/css/
通过以上方法,开发者可以灵活地在TP5项目中引入CSS文件。建议根据项目规模选择合适的方式,小型项目可直接使用静态目录,中大型项目可考虑结合构建工具管理静态资源。 “`
(注:实际字符数约650字,如需精简至450字可删除部分示例或注意事项)
免责声明:本站发布的内容(图片、视频和文字)以原创、转载和分享为主,文章观点不代表本网站立场,如果涉及侵权请联系站长邮箱:is@yisu.com进行举报,并提供相关证据,一经查实,将立刻删除涉嫌侵权内容。